Nice work on the Marrowset dedupe pass. One ask: the fuzzy-match thresholds are scattered through the merge logic, which will bite whoever tunes this next. Pull them into one spot so future maintainers can adjust match confidence without spelunking. I'd group them right here—the relevant constants follow below.

limits module of fajog-tawig:
RATE_LIMITS = {
    "druwyn": 2,
    "quenael": 10,
    "wenix": 2,
    "druael": 2,
}

**Handover Note — from Priya to Callum**

Callum, quick rundown before I'm off. The marketing budget cut lands next quarter: roughly 20% off the Lanternfield campaign and a freeze on new agency work with Bramblehart Creative. Heads of department already know the headline number, but not the reallocation logic. Keep the tone calm in the all-hands — it's a trim, not a crisis. The reasoning behind the cut is set out just below.

board note of bawep-tajef: Queniusek Systems plans to raise the Quenvan list price by 53.1 percent in March. The pricing group signed off on a budget of $176.4 million for Project Drueth. The renewal with Casionix Partners closes at $142.5 million a year, 8.3 percent below the last contract. Project Fraax slips by six weeks because of the tooling delay.

## Deploying the Gatewick Proctor Queue

Deploys are pretty painless: push to main, wait for the pipeline, then watch the queue drain dashboard for five minutes. If candidates pile up mid-exam, roll back first and ask questions later — the queue replays safely. Everything the workers care about lives in one config block, shown here for reference.

settings of bafof-yagef:
JOROX_PIN=8740
JOROX_TENANT=pelox
JOROX_METRICS_HOST=metrics.jorox.qorvelworks.internal
JOROX_SEAL=seal_c78f63c1
JOROX_STANDBY_TEAM=norax